: My bushy is being a real gas hog. I'm getting around 300 shots out of my 48ci tank. I have a vigilante reg, and a freak barrel. I just installed a new wiring harness if that makes a difference. : Any help would be greatly appreciated ::: Is your 48ci a 3,000 psi tank? If so, even if you improve your air efficiency you will be limited as to how much paint you can shoot. A 68/4,500 makes a lot more sense. Even so, only 300 shots is not good. :::The wiring harness should make no difference. The Freak means that your paint/barrel match should be good (not way loose). The Vigilante shouldn't cause any efficiency problems (though you want to make sure that it's clean and the o-ring is lightly greased). I assume you are using the stock valve and bolt. I would: 1- check for any leaks, 2- check my LP reg to see that it'snot set above 90 psi (find someone with a Sonic pressure gauge for the Bushy), 3- check to see that the ram mechanism is clean, greased and working smoothly. If all these check out OK, you may have a solenoid problem, and may want to send the gun to ICD to check and fix (though you may want to replace the stock inline reg so they will fix it on warrantee).
